Simple and fast Malaria-LAMP workflow

The LoopampTM workflow allows for the easy DNA extraction and preparation of reaction mixes in a few steps without any additional equipment. Reagent storage and shipment at room temperature and the excellent test performance make molecular pathogen testing available in rural areas with limited settings.

High reliability ensured by best performance

  • Sensitivity of 96 – 100 % and specificity of 97 – 100 %
  • Detection limit of 1 parasite / μl
  • Differentiation between Plasmodium pan species, P. falciparum and P. vivax
